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
53205875 83513 52496469410
562 3166700336 8991
562 3166700336 8991
71024468 0817 546 01 5959
All about undefined
Interested in learning more?
562 3166700336 8991
71024468 0817 546 01 5959
See more
782915567 56612212781
41088729878 61 46819566
See more
93585 5997015 68725
8064488268 89116429 3117 9704
See more